Output 3f5cbde66fbc56eecdb9ee3d1484247772e792fc2a109bbc03e8348c51112aaa: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0856fcf8ff6a198bb6aedf001eb45f91d91a56 OP_EQUAL
address
3HHMTohoNN2EWZAH6Lwq3ABBW5W4ipE9NT
transaction
3f5cbde66fbc56eecdb9ee3d1484247772e792fc2a109bbc03e8348c51112aaa
confirmations
13496
spent
true